jQuery入门教程:从零开始探索jQuery的世界
需积分: 11 79 浏览量
更新于2024-10-25
收藏 1.6MB PDF 举报
"从零开始学习jQuery.pdf"
在深入学习jQuery之前,我们先来理解这个流行的JavaScript库的基础概念。jQuery是由John Resig于2006年创建的,它以其简洁的API和强大的功能赢得了广大开发者的心。jQuery的核心理念是“Write Less, Do More”,它通过封装复杂的DOM操作、事件处理、动画效果和Ajax交互,使得JavaScript编程变得更加简单。
jQuery的入门并不难,对于初学者,首先需要了解的是jQuery的基本语法。比如,选择器是jQuery的灵魂,它能让你快速定位到网页中的HTML元素。例如,`$("#elementID")`用于选取ID为`elementID`的元素,`$(".className")`则选取所有class为`className`的元素。jQuery提供了多种选择器,包括ID选择器、类选择器、属性选择器等,使你能灵活地选取需要操作的元素。
接下来,要掌握jQuery中的DOM操作。这些操作包括添加、删除、复制和修改元素。例如,`$("p").append("新的内容")`会在所有的段落元素后面添加新的内容。此外,`html()`, `text()`, 和`val()`函数分别用于获取或设置元素的HTML内容、文本内容和表单字段的值。
jQuery的事件处理也是其强大之处。使用`$(element).click(function() {...})`可以为元素绑定点击事件,而`$(document).ready(function() {...})`则是确保在页面加载完成后执行某些代码,这是jQuery中常见的DOM就绪事件。
动画效果是jQuery的另一个亮点。`fadeIn()`, `fadeOut()`, `slideToggle()`等函数能轻松实现元素的淡入淡出、滑动切换等动态效果,极大地提升了用户体验。
Ajax是jQuery中不可或缺的一部分,它简化了与服务器的异步数据交换。`$.ajax()`, `$.get()`, `$.post()`等函数让你能在不刷新页面的情况下发送HTTP请求,实现局部刷新。
至于开发环境,如描述中提到的,Visual Studio对jQuery提供了很好的支持。在VS中,你可以享受到代码补全、错误检查等便利,这将极大地提高开发效率。
此外,jQuery有一个庞大的插件生态系统,提供了各种预封装的功能,如轮播图、日期选择器、表单验证等,这使得开发者无需从零开始编写复杂的功能,只需简单集成即可。
jQuery是JavaScript开发者的重要工具,它降低了前端开发的复杂性,提高了开发速度。通过深入学习和实践,你可以掌握这一强大的库,为你的网页开发注入活力。在学习过程中,参考书籍如“jQuery实战”是极好的辅助资料,它们将帮助你理解和掌握jQuery的精髓。现在,让我们开启这段jQuery的探索之旅吧!
点击了解资源详情
104 浏览量
点击了解资源详情
2011-09-13 上传
225 浏览量
115 浏览量
2011-07-13 上传
216 浏览量
![](https://profile-avatar.csdnimg.cn/default.jpg!1)
blainelijia
- 粉丝: 2
最新资源
- 打造仿iOS效果的底部弹出Dialog
- Unity3D点缓存动画识别插件:全平台支持与网格变形
- Java内存分配算法实现:轮转法与高优先权法
- Emacs Overlay:每日更新的Emacs版本与EXWM依赖项
- C++全局钩子打造TopWnd仿制程序
- Python梯度下降分类算法在婚恋配对系统中的应用
- MATLAB实现RTK技术的球心拟合精度分析
- 全面解析easyui文档及案例教程
- ApogeeJS视图库:下一代JavaScript前端开发工具
- 解决Win7系统下USB键盘不识别的万能键盘驱动
- Dracul模块化框架:前后端JavaScript Web应用开发集锦
- Android与Java反编译利器:Fernflower使用教程
- 简化网络传输: 飞鸽传书实现PC间无网线快速互传
- 掌握Nuxt.js沙盒模式:开发与部署Vue项目
- 大数据技术栈面试问题汇总:Hadoop, Spark, Hive
- 掌握无服务器技术:sls-appsync-backend项目解析